We found evidence for six different methods of managing a miscarriage; three surgical methods (suction aspiration plus cervical preparation, dilatation and curettage, or suction aspiration), two medical methods (mifepristone plus misoprostol or misoprostol alone), and expectant management or placebo.

  5. 19 lis 2021 · Results: Three effective and safe treatment options are available after a diagnosis of early miscarriage. Expectant treatment yields success rates of 66-91%, depending on the type of miscarriage. Its complications include hemorrhage requiring blood transfusion in 1-2% of cases.

  7. 19 cze 2013 · Transvaginal ultrasound is the best way to diagnose miscarriage. Most miscarriages resolve spontaneously and expectant management should be offered as the first line management strategy. Emergency surgery is indicated in women presenting with severe pain or bleeding and in those with signs of infection.
